JL men held for damaging Bangabandhu’s portrait in Jessore

Awami League men handed over two activists of Juba League to police after picking up them from their residences at Nizampur under Sharsha upazila in Jessore on Friday for allegedly damaging the portraits of Bangabandhu Sheikh Mujibur Rahman and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ina. Mohiuddim Mia, officer in-charge, Investigation of Sharsha police station confirmed the matter. .
Police and Awami League sources said, two activists of Juba League, youth wing of the ruling party – M Asad and Jafar Ali were picked up and then handed them over to Gorpara camp police as they were allegedly damaged photographs of Sheikh Mujibur Rahman, founder president of the country and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ina at Nizampur union unit office of the ruling party in the morning.
The pictures were damaged over feud of two factions of the ruling party. Abul Kalam Azad, Cultural Affairs Secretary of Sharsha upazila unit AL have feud with Saidul Member, former organising secretary of Nizampur union unit Juba League.
